Mandatory face coverings in Richmond Hill
At the June 24 Council meeting, I made an emergency motion to ask staff to explore the possibility of enacting a bylaw to make face coverings mandatory in all public and commercial indoor establishments in the City of Richmond Hill. The motion passed 8-1. Richmond Hill is the first municipality in GTA to pass such a motion.
We are now awaiting York Region to implement a region-wide bylaw. York Region Council will be debating this issue at their July 9 meeting. If you want your voice heard at the Regional level, please contact our Regional representatives:

Official Plan Amendment – Car Dealerships on Leslie Street
Last week, I sent a survey to the residents of Ward 3 to collect their input regarding the employment land conversion proposal by staff to allow car dealerships on Leslie Street. I received over 1,000 responses in which 95% of the residents oppose this proposal.
Last night at the Council Public Meeting, on behalf of the residents, I sent a strong message to staff that this proposal is not supported by the community due to its close proximity to the existing residential area. Majority of Council also agreed with me.
I am confident that Council will make every effort to prevent this from happening. Thank you for voicing your concerns.
